Doug Ward - 90 Years Young
Doug Ward, 90 years young, is a current student of Nancy Scela’s at the Nancy Stephen Gallery and School of Art.
He recently exhibited 25 of his paintings at his home, The Harborhill Place in East Greenwich. Doug, a RI native, began studying art in 2002, first working in acrylics and watercolors before switching to oils in 2007. His love of the water and boats is evident in many of his works.
His exhibit ran November 3-5, 2010.

February 11, 2010 - EG Pendulum
Nancy Stephen Gallery
15 Years in East Greenwich
In a slow-growth economy like today’s, how does a small art school survive, like the Nancy Stephen on King Street?
“We built our success on reputation,” said owner Nancy Scelsa. “The need is there; otherwise, we wouldn’t be here. We love being here for the community and when you have the right attitude, it multiplies.” Whatever financial condition the state or the country is in, “You’re always going to have the need for fine arts,” she said.....
